Paris Saint-Germain dominate AS Monaco in thrilling 5-2 victory

NEW DELHI: Paris Saint-Germain (PSG) secured a commanding 5-2 win over AS Monaco on Friday, further solidifying their hold on the top spot in Ligue 1.

Goncalo Ramos, Kylian Mbappe, Ousmane Dembele, Vitinha, and Randal Kolo Muani all found the net for PSG, showcasing a diverse attacking force. Monaco, however, managed to respond with goals from Takumi Minamino and Folarin Balogun.

With this victory, Luis Enrique's side now sits comfortably at the summit of Ligue 1 with 30 points, four points clear of second-placed Nice, who are set to face Toulouse on Sunday. Monaco holds the third position with 24 points.

Speaking in a post-match news conference, Luis Enrique expressed satisfaction with the thrilling encounter, stating, "When two teams of this level play a match like today's, every fan enjoys a game with seven goals."

The PSG manager also praised the team's attitude after the international break, acknowledging the challenges coaches face in preparing for such high-intensity games.

The scoring commenced in the 18th minute as Ramos capitalised on a rebound from Monaco goalkeeper Philipp Kohn. However, Monaco quickly responded with Minamino equalising four minutes later after a mistake by PSG keeper Gianluigi Donnarumma.

Donnarumma redeemed himself with crucial saves throughout the match, with Luis Enrique commending the goalkeeper's exceptional season. Mbappe extended PSG's lead with a penalty in the 39th minute, solidifying his position as Ligue 1's top scorer with 14 goals this season.

Dembele added to the tally 20 minutes from time, followed by Vitinha's superb strike from the edge of the box just two minutes later. Balogun pulled one back for Monaco in the 75th minute, but Kolo Muani sealed the victory for PSG in stoppage time.

Looking ahead, PSG are set to host Newcastle United in a crucial Champions League Group F clash on Tuesday. Luis Enrique emphasised the importance of winning to maintain their top position and enter the Champions League fixture with confidence.
